Transaction 42ee60d4cbc3bf5a5085f20d856d947cc1565d06ed60b73fc2cc704aeb76bbb5

2 Input
2 Outputs
  • 42ee60d4cbc3bf5a5085f20d856d947cc1565d06ed60b73fc2cc704aeb76bbb5:0
  • value  9998858
    address  mhJ28jKwqfpPToRCZsY9PuRxrwP5vSDUZ4
  • 42ee60d4cbc3bf5a5085f20d856d947cc1565d06ed60b73fc2cc704aeb76bbb5:1
  • value  10000000
    address  mx6TouyVV36LEpvYqKgNntbRknha2pbmss